Savory Oatcakes

2 cups oatmeal

1 cup milk of choice or water

1/2 cup yogurt

2 tbsp goat cheese (or shredded mozzarella)

1/2 tbsp maple syrup

1 egg

1/2 tsp salt

1/4 tsp cinnamon

2 tbsp. fresh parsley (or pretty much any green), chopped

1/4 tsp baking soda

Splash of milk

Toppings: avocado, tomatoes, pesto, fried egg, sausage, pretty much anything

Directions:

1. Blend 1 cup of oatmeal into flour

2. Add the oat flour and regular oatmeal to a medium sized bowl

3. Add water/milk, yogurt, goat cheese, maple syrup, egg, salt and cinnamon and mix well

4. Preheat griddle

5. Add chopped parsley and baking soda to mix. Might need to add a splash of milk

6. Using either butter, ghee or coconut oil drizzle onto griddle. Pour batter into even circles

7. Cook for 3-5 minutes on each side (or until brown)

8. Serve with all your favorite toppings!
